Town of Great Barrington Tree Warden NOTICE OF PUBLIC HEARING In accordance with Massachusetts General Laws (MGL), Chapter 87, Public Shade Tree Law, Section 3 (Cutting of Public Shade Trees; Hearing; Damages), the Town of Great Barrington Tree Warden will hold a Public Hearing regarding an application from National Grid to remove or prune public shade trees on Monday, October 25, 2021 at 6:00 p.m. virtually. Details of how to join the Virtual Meeting will be posted on the town's website, www.townofgb.org prior to the meeting. The program included a tree-by-tree hazard assessment of public and private trees, along the main three-phase lines which serve the community. The work is recommended to remove hazard trees and prune for additional clearance in order to reduce tree outage problems affecting large numbers of customers served by these main lines. National Grid's arborists have identified twenty-nine (29) town-owned trees for removal along Park Street and Lake Buel Road. Town trees located within the public way that are designated for removal have been posted with a notice of public hearing in the field. A complete list of town trees designated for removal including information about the location, size and species of the affected trees and the reason for work proposed, is available on the town's website, the Post Office and the Town Hall during normal business hours.
